The Oakland University Libraries seek a highly dependable, resourceful part-time librarian to deliver in-person library instruction to first-year students and to contribute to the creation, evaluation and implementation of online learning objects (interactive tutorials, videos, etc.). In addition, the successful candidate will provide exceptional research assistance through individual consultations with library users and at our reference desk, and contribute to other library projects as assigned, including assisting with collection development activities.
Hours: May include weekday,
evening and weekend shifts,15 hours/week, beginning Sept. 1, 2016.
Qualifications:
Required: ALA-accredited MLS or
equivalent with a strong commitment to teaching and public service; experience in developing learning objects, instructional videos,
and online tutorials; familiarity with a wide
range of instructional technologies (e.g., Camtasia, Jing, Adobe Captivate,
etc.); experience
providing reference service.
Desired: Library instruction
experience, preferably in an academic library setting; familiarity with learning management systems and the ability to
integrate instructional technologies in courses with a library component.
